GMs Uneasy About Gambling Fallout After Emmanuel Clase, Luis Ortiz Charges

At GM meetings in Las Vegas, executives wrestled with gambling fallout after Clase and Ortiz were charged in a pitch-fixing scheme. Cubs boss Jed Hoyer warned phone betting makes abuse inevitable, while Scott Boras urged a full ban on pitch props, calling $200 limits meaningless. Others stressed player safety, yet many GMs deflected responsibility toward MLB's betting ties.
